Add local auth: users, sessions, register/login/logout/me (#4)
Implements pansy's local (email + password) authentication and the
session layer that OIDC (#5) will also reuse.

- store: users.go (create/get-by-id/get-by-email/count) and sessions.go
  (create/get/touch/delete/delete-expired), scanning the existing 0001
  schema.
- service: the business-logic seam. auth.go (Register/Login/session
  lifecycle/Providers) + password.go (argon2id, 64 MiB/1/4, PHC-encoded,
  constant-time verify) + service.go (Service, clock injection, token
  hashing). First user is admin; closed registration still allows the
  bootstrap user; unknown-email and wrong-password are indistinguishable
  (same error, same argon2 work via a dummy hash).
- api: POST /auth/register|login|logout, GET /auth/me|providers, plus a
  requireAuth middleware that resolves the HttpOnly session cookie
  (SameSite=Lax, Secure under https) to the actor. Handlers stay thin.
- main: wires the service and a periodic expired-session sweep; sessions
  are also dropped lazily on access. Sliding 30-day expiry.
- tests: service (register/login/expiry/renewal/cleanup, password) and
  api (cookie flow, middleware, validation, providers).

Verified end-to-end via curl: register -> me -> restart -> session
persists -> logout -> 401.

// Package domain holds pansy's core types: plain structs mirroring the database
// schema and the sentinel errors the service layer returns. It has no
// dependencies on store, api, or any framework — every other package depends on
// it, not the other way around.
package domain
import "errors"
// Sentinel errors returned by the service layer and mapped to HTTP status codes
// by the API layer (404, 403, 409 respectively).
var (
// ErrNotFound means the requested entity does not exist (or is invisible to
// the actor, when we deliberately mask existence).
ErrNotFound = errors.New("not found")
// ErrForbidden means the actor is known but lacks permission for the action.
ErrForbidden = errors.New("forbidden")
// ErrVersionConflict means the row's version did not match the one supplied
// with a PATCH/DELETE; the caller should refetch and retry.
ErrVersionConflict = errors.New("version conflict")
// ErrInvalidInput means the caller supplied structurally invalid data (empty
// required field, malformed value). Mapped to 400.
ErrInvalidInput = errors.New("invalid input")
// ErrInvalidCredentials means a login attempt failed. It is deliberately
// identical for an unknown email and a wrong password so neither can be
// enumerated. Mapped to 401.
ErrInvalidCredentials = errors.New("invalid credentials")
// ErrEmailTaken means registration collided with an existing account's email.
// Mapped to 409.
ErrEmailTaken = errors.New("email already registered")
// ErrRegistrationClosed means local self-service signup is disabled and at
// least one user already exists (the very first user may always register to
// bootstrap the instance). Mapped to 403.
ErrRegistrationClosed = errors.New("registration closed")
// ErrLocalAuthDisabled means PANSY_LOCAL_AUTH=false, so local register/login
// are rejected in favor of OIDC. Mapped to 403.
ErrLocalAuthDisabled = errors.New("local authentication disabled")
)

// User is a pansy account. It may have a local password, OIDC identity, or both.
type User struct {
ID int64 `json:"id"`
Email string `json:"email"`
DisplayName string `json:"displayName"`
PasswordHash *string `json:"-"` // never serialized
OIDCIssuer *string `json:"-"`
OIDCSubject *string `json:"-"`
IsAdmin bool `json:"isAdmin"`
Version int64 `json:"version"`
CreatedAt string `json:"createdAt"`
UpdatedAt string `json:"updatedAt"`
}
// Session is a server-side session record. The raw token is never stored; only
// its sha256 hash (the primary key) is.
type Session struct {
TokenHash string `json:"-"`
UserID int64 `json:"userId"`
ExpiresAt string `json:"expiresAt"`
CreatedAt string `json:"createdAt"`
}
